Job Description

Quality Engineer

Location: Norcross
Working hours:

DEUTZ is one of the worlds leading manufacturers of innovative drive systems. Its core competences are the development production distribution and servicing of diesel gas and electric drivetrains for professional applications that is used in construction equipment agricultural machinery material handling equipment stationary equipment commercial vehicles rail vehicles and other applications.

Job Summary

Position Summary

The Quality Engineer will be responsible for coordination and execution of the Customer and Engineering Quality functions in interaction with the Quality Engineering and Technical Customer Support Departments of DEUTZ Corporation Americas and DEUTZ AG.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

The Quality Engineer will be responsible for but not limited to the following duties:

  • Interface between DEUTZ customers in Americas and DEUTZ with a strong relation to Engineering and
  • Technical Customer Support teams.
  • Identification correction and prevention of defect root causes generated within DEUTZ Corporation.
  • Communication and follow up of the identification correction and prevention of defect root causes
  • generated in DEUTZ facilities outside of the Americas.
  • Assist with coordination of quality defects outside of the Americas as required.
  • Coordination of warranty claim analysis help desk ticket analysis and field testing in close
  • coordination with Technical Customer Support team.
  • Participation and representation of Customer Quality in project team meetings.
  • Risk analysis and documentation of lessons learned within the Product Development Process.
  • Process implementation and improvement of Customer Quality relevant processes.
  • Assist with Internal Audits in cooperation with Corporate Quality team.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

Other Qualifications

  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Good computer skills and knowledge of computer software (e.g. SAP MS office).
  • Ability to read technical drawings (GD&T).
  • Process oriented.
  • Supervisory Responsibility
  • None

Travel Requirements

  • Anticipate domestic travel of 0-10% travel

Minimum Requirements

  • Degree in Mechanical engineering or similar advanced technical education background.
  • Minimum 3 years of previous Quality Assurance experience.
  • Knowledge of tools and methodology as well as ISO Standards.
  • Excellent knowledge in technical English language.

Preferred Requirements

  • Diesel Engine background or engine repair experience.
  • Knowledge of German language.
  • SAP knowledge.

Physical Requirements:

  • Manufacturing assembly and warehouse environment. Subject to noise dust diesel fuel oil and extreme hot/cold temperatures. No A/C.
  • If the employee is in the office area the noise level in the work environment is usually quiet to moderate.
